As an Operative/ Groundworker your duties and responsibilities will be a large range of practical tasks ranging from digging trenches, placing and compacting bedding material, laying pipes, ducts and cables. Backfilling and compacting trenches, mix and lay concrete, operate machinery, use equipment such as drills and pumps, fitting doors and roofs on kiosk, painting blasting and coating.
The work may also include fencing work, CP works, construction of foundations and assisting skilled workers for example Steel fixers and Carpenters. Working under the instruction and supervision of a Site Manager. The work may involve the driving of plant construction site vehicles as well as acting as a Banksman. Keeping the site tidy and looking after tools and equipment. Aiding the site team which may include a number of varied tasks. At all times to be working in a safe manner with consideration towards fellow workers and members of the public who may come into contact with our work.
